The Lover of No Fixed Abode

Book • 1986
The story begins with a chance encounter on a flight to Venice between a Roman aristocrat and art expert, and Mr. Silvera, a mysterious and erudite tourist guide.

As they navigate the city, they become embroiled in a world of unscrupulous art dealers and fake artworks.

The novel is a blend of mystery, romance, and wit, with Venice itself playing a central role.

The characters' elusive nature and the city's hidden flaws add to the intrigue, leading to a surprising and thought-provoking conclusion.
